CarGurus Logo Homepage Link
  • Buy
    • Used cars
    • New cars
    • Certified pre-owned
    • Start your purchase online
  • Sell
    • Sell my car
    • Car values
  • Research
    • Test drive reviews
    • Price trends
    • Compare cars
  • Saved cars & searches
  • Sign in / Register
    • My account
    • Saved searches
    • Saved cars
    • Recommended cars
    • Browsing history
      • United States (EN)
      • Estados Unidos (ES)
      • Canada (EN)
      • Canada (FR)
      • United Kingdom

Used Mazda MAZDA3 for Sale Under $40,000 Near Niagara Falls, ON

536 results
Niagara Falls, ON
2020 Mazda MAZDA3 Hatchback FWD Auto Moto

2020 Mazda MAZDA3

Hatchback FWD

52,780 kilometres

$21,995

Good Deal
Burlington, ON
64 km away
Year:
2020
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Doors:
4 doors
Drivetrain:
Front-Wheel Drive
Engine:
186 hp 2.5L I4
Exterior colour:
Black
Fuel type:
Gasoline
Interior colour:
Black
Transmission:
Manual
Mileage:
52,780
Stock number:
A3726
VIN:
JM1BPALM5L1150600

Sponsored

2021 Mazda MAZDA3 GT Sedan AWD

2021 Mazda MAZDA3

GT Sedan AWD

80,916 kilometres

$23,490

Fair Deal
67 km away
Year:
2021
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Black
Interior colour:
Black
Transmission:
Automatic
Mileage:
80,916
Stock number:
84346
VIN:
JM1BPBDY8M1320778

Sponsored

2014 Mazda MAZDA3 GT Sedan

2014 Mazda MAZDA3

GT Sedan

199,992 kilometres

$8,880

Good Deal
North York, ON
82 km away
Year:
2014
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Gray
Transmission:
Automatic
Mileage:
199,992
Stock number:
80429
VIN:
JM1BM1W37E1108511

Sponsored

2017 Mazda MAZDA3 GT

2017 Mazda MAZDA3

GT

135,200 kilometres

$12,490

Great Deal
Ajax, ON
83 km away
Year:
2017
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Gray
Transmission:
Automatic
Mileage:
135,200
Stock number:
140543
VIN:
JM1BN1W32H1140543

2018 Mazda MAZDA3 GT

2018 Mazda MAZDA3

GT

177,917 kilometres

$11,999

Great Deal
Toronto, ON
65 km away
Year:
2018
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Blue
Interior colour:
Black
Transmission:
Automatic
Mileage:
177,917
VIN:
3MZBN1W3XJM191567

2016 Mazda MAZDA3 i Sport

2016 Mazda MAZDA3

i Sport

128,000 kilometres

$9,499

Great Deal
St. Catharines, ON
14 km away
Year:
2016
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Doors:
4 doors
Drivetrain:
Front-Wheel Drive
Engine:
155 hp 2L I4
Exterior colour:
Black
Combined gas mileage:
7 L/100km
Fuel type:
Gasoline
Transmission:
Manual
Mileage:
128,000
Stock number:
000022
VIN:
JM1BM1U78G1325168

Preparing for a close up...

Photos coming soon

2022 Mazda MAZDA3

GT Sedan with Turbo FWD

68,388 kilometres

$24,898

Great Deal
Toronto, ON
74 km away
Year:
2022
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Gray
Transmission:
Automatic
Mileage:
68,388
Stock number:
P788
VIN:
3MZBPBDY3NM300813

Preparing for a close up...

Photos coming soon

2024 Mazda MAZDA3

GT Sedan AWD with Turbo

29,594 kilometres

$26,998

Great Deal
St Catharines, ON
12 km away
Year:
2024
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
White
Transmission:
Automatic
Mileage:
29,594
Stock number:
E1665
VIN:
JM1BPBDYXR1658125

Preparing for a close up...

Photos coming soon

2019 Mazda MAZDA3

GT Sedan FWD

135,563 kilometres

$14,999

Great Deal
Mississauga, ON
75 km away
Year:
2019
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Black
Transmission:
Automatic
Mileage:
135,563
Stock number:
128606
VIN:
JM1BPADMXK1128606

Preparing for a close up...

Photos coming soon

2022 Mazda MAZDA3

Premium Plus Sedan AWD

72,000 kilometres

$24,991

Great Deal
Mississauga, ON
80 km away
Year:
2022
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Doors:
4 doors
Drivetrain:
All-Wheel Drive
Engine:
186 hp 2.5L I4
Exterior colour:
Brown (Beige)
Fuel type:
Gasoline
Interior colour:
Black
Transmission:
Automatic
Mileage:
72,000
Stock number:
PCS0393
VIN:
3MZBPBDL1NM300393

Preparing for a close up...

Photos coming soon

2024 Mazda MAZDA3

GT Sedan AWD with Turbo

79,863 kilometres

$25,999

Great Deal
Certified Pre-Owned
Maple, ON
89 km away
Year:
2024
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Silver
Transmission:
Automatic
Mileage:
79,863
Stock number:
P-3244
VIN:
JM1BPBDY4R1657875

Preparing for a close up...

Photos coming soon

2021 Mazda MAZDA3

GS Sedan FWD

47,778 kilometres

$18,499

Great Deal
Pickering, ON
81 km away
Year:
2021
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Blue
Transmission:
Automatic
Mileage:
47,778
Stock number:
204349
VIN:
3MZBPACL8MM204349

Preparing for a close up...

Photos coming soon

2012 Mazda MAZDA3

i Touring Hatchback

187,623 kilometres

$3,380

Great Deal
North York, ON
71 km away
Year:
2012
Make:
Mazda
Model:
MAZDA3
Body type:
Hatchback
Engine:
155 hp 2L I4
Exterior colour:
Silver
Fuel type:
Gasoline
Transmission:
Manual
Mileage:
187,623
Stock number:
8P6930
VIN:
JM1BL1L74C1648244

Preparing for a close up...

Photos coming soon

2018 Mazda MAZDA3

GS

64,680 kilometres

$11,499

Great Deal
Pickering, ON
81 km away
Year:
2018
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Silver
Transmission:
Manual
Mileage:
64,680
Stock number:
2C9FC0
VIN:
3MZBN1V74JM225071

Preparing for a close up...

Photos coming soon

2016 Mazda MAZDA3

i Touring Hatchback

121,064 kilometres

$8,999

Great Deal
Pickering, ON
81 km away
Year:
2016
Make:
Mazda
Model:
MAZDA3
Body type:
Hatchback
Engine:
155 hp 2L I4
Exterior colour:
Brown
Fuel type:
Gasoline
Transmission:
Automatic
Mileage:
121,064
Stock number:
239317
VIN:
3MZBM1L75GM239317

Preparing for a close up...

Photos coming soon

2019 Mazda MAZDA3

GT Sedan AWD

67,174 kilometres

$16,999

Great Deal
Pickering, ON
81 km away
Year:
2019
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Red
Transmission:
Automatic
Mileage:
67,174
Stock number:
147064
VIN:
JM1BPBDMXK1147061

Preparing for a close up...

Photos coming soon

2024 Mazda MAZDA3

GT Sedan AWD with Turbo

10,536 kilometres

$25,499

Great Deal
Pickering, ON
81 km away
Year:
2024
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Blue
Transmission:
Automatic
Mileage:
10,536
Stock number:
657676
VIN:
JM1BPBDY9R1657677

Preparing for a close up...

Photos coming soon

2018 Mazda MAZDA3

GS

18,369 kilometres

$13,999

Great Deal
Pickering, ON
81 km away
Year:
2018
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Red
Transmission:
Automatic
Mileage:
18,369
Stock number:
228071
VIN:
3MZBN1V78JM228072

Preparing for a close up...

Photos coming soon

2022 Mazda MAZDA3

GX Sedan FWD

33,101 kilometres

$16,971

Great Deal
Toronto, ON
68 km away
Year:
2022
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Blue
Interior colour:
Black
Transmission:
Automatic
Mileage:
33,101
VIN:
JM1BPAB75N1501083

Preparing for a close up...

Photos coming soon

2015 Mazda MAZDA3

i Touring Hatchback

124,500 kilometres

$12,490

Good Deal
Ajax, ON
83 km away
Year:
2015
Make:
Mazda
Model:
MAZDA3
Body type:
Hatchback
Engine:
155 hp 2L I4
Exterior colour:
Brown
Fuel type:
Gasoline
Transmission:
Automatic
Mileage:
124,500
Stock number:
179102
VIN:
3MZBM1L73FM179102

Preparing for a close up...

Photos coming soon

2015 Mazda MAZDA3

GS

121,190 kilometres

$10,995

Good Deal
Toronto, ON
73 km away
Year:
2015
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Black
Transmission:
Automatic
Mileage:
121,190
Stock number:
232774
VIN:
3MZBM1V74FM232774

Preparing for a close up...

Photos coming soon

2021 Mazda MAZDA3

GT Sedan AWD

75,677 kilometres

$23,499

Good Deal
Scarborough, ON
73 km away
Year:
2021
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Gray
Transmission:
Automatic
Mileage:
75,677
Stock number:
348244
VIN:
JM1BPBDY1M1348244

Preparing for a close up...

Photos coming soon

2024 Mazda MAZDA3

GX Sedan FWD

24,896 kilometres

$24,499

Good Deal
Scarborough, ON
75 km away
Year:
2024
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
White
Transmission:
Automatic
Mileage:
24,896
Stock number:
P0139
VIN:
JM1BPABM0R1716608

Preparing for a close up...

Photos coming soon

2025 Mazda MAZDA3

GX Sedan FWD

12,650 kilometres

$26,490

Fair Deal
67 km away
Year:
2025
Make:
Mazda
Model:
MAZDA3
Body type:
Sedan
Exterior colour:
Gray
Interior colour:
Black
Transmission:
Automatic
Mileage:
12,650
Stock number:
85460
VIN:
JM1BPABM5S1765390

Sponsored

  1. Home
  2. / Used Cars
  3. / Mazda MAZDA3
  4. / Ontario
  5. / Niagara Falls
  • Used White Mazda MAZDA3 for Sale

  • Used Blue Mazda MAZDA3 for Sale

  • Used Red Mazda MAZDA3 for Sale

  • Used Black Mazda MAZDA3 for Sale

  • Used Silver Mazda MAZDA3 for Sale

  • Used Gray Mazda MAZDA3 for Sale

  • All Used Cars

  • Cheap Cars

  • Manual Transmission Cars

  • Sports Cars

  • Hybrid Cars

  • Red Interior Cars

  • Electric Cars

  • Small Cars

  • AWD Cars

  • Cheap Automatic Transmission Cars

  • Classic Trucks

  • Conversion Vans

  • Three Quarter Ton Trucks

  • Diesel Trucks

  • Small Trucks

  • Chevrolet Diesel Trucks

  • Manual Diesel Trucks

  • One Ton Trucks

  • Cheap Trucks

  • Ford Trucks

  • Cheap SUVs

  • Mercedes-Benz Convertibles

  • Ford Diesel Trucks

  • Mercedes-Benz SUVs

  • BMW Convertibles

  • Chevrolet SUVs

  • Toyota SUVs

  • Nissan SUVs

  • Used Cars Under $10,000

  • Used Cars Under $5,000

  • Used Sedans for Sale with Low Mileage

  • Used SUVs / Crossovers for Sale with Low Mileage

  • Used Hatchbacks for Sale with Low Mileage

  • Used Convertibles for Sale with Low Mileage

  • Used Vans for Sale with Low Mileage

  • Used Minivans for Sale with Low Mileage

  • Used Pickup Trucks for Sale with Low Mileage

  • Used Coupes for Sale with Low Mileage

  • Used Wagons for Sale with Low Mileage

  • Gyro Mazda

  • Mazda of Hamilton

  • Erin Mills Mazda

  • Scarboro Mazda

  • Leggat Mazda Burlington

  • Budds' Mazda

  • Westowne Mazda

  • Used Mazda MAZDA3 for Sale Under $40,000 Near St Catharines

  • Used Mazda MAZDA3 for Sale Under $40,000 Near Welland

  • Used Mazda MAZDA3 for Sale Under $40,000 Near Stoney Creek

  • Used Mazda MAZDA3 for Sale Under $40,000 Near Burlington

  • Used Mazda MAZDA3 for Sale Under $40,000 Near Oakville

  • Used Mazda MAZDA3 for Sale Under $40,000 Near Toronto

  • Used Mazda MAZDA3 for Sale Under $40,000 Near Cayuga

  • Used Mazda MAZDA3 for Sale Under $40,000 Near Hamilton

  • Used Mazda MAZDA3 for Sale Under $40,000 Near Mississauga

Connect with us
Download our app
Download on the App Store Get it on Google Play
  • Company
  • About CarGurus
  • Our team
  • Press
  • Investor relations
  • Price trends
  • Advertise with CarGurus
  • For dealers
  • Dealer signup
  • Dealer resources
  • Terms
  • Terms of use
  • Privacy policy
  • Interest-based ads
  • Security
  • Help
  • Help center
  • Contact us
    • United States (EN)
    • Estados Unidos (ES)
    • Canada (EN)
    • Canada (FR)
    • United Kingdom

© 2026 CarGurus, Inc., All Rights Reserved.